Course Details
• Introduction to Precision Kidney Testing: Overview of the field, its importance, and the benefits of precise kidney function assessment. • Traditional Kidney Function Tests: Examination of conventional serum creatinine and estimated glomerular filtration rate (eGFR) tests, including their limitations. • Emerging Biomarkers in Kidney Testing: Exploration of novel biomarkers for kidney injury and disease, such as cystatin C, neutrophil gelatinase-associated lipocalin (NGAL), and kidney injury molecule-1 (KIM-1). • Clinical Applications of Precision Kidney Testing: Examination of how precise kidney testing can improve patient management, including early detection, prognosis, and personalized treatment. • Interpreting Precision Kidney Test Results: Guidance on understanding the results of precision kidney tests, including how to evaluate accuracy, precision, and clinical significance. • Laboratory Techniques for Precision Kidney Testing: Overview of the analytical techniques used in precision kidney testing, such as immunoassays, mass spectrometry, and imaging. • Integrating Precision Kidney Testing into Clinical Practice: Examination of the practical considerations for implementing precision kidney testing, including cost-effectiveness, workflow, and regulatory requirements. • Ethical and Legal Considerations in Precision Kidney Testing: Discussion of the ethical and legal issues surrounding precision kidney testing, including data privacy, informed consent, and medical liability.
